    • The destabilizing effect of two soft ligands in mutual trans positions has been called antisymbiosis, see: (a)
    • The destabilizing effect of two soft ligands in mutual trans positions has been called antisymbiosis, see: (a) Davies, J. A.; Hartley, F. R. Chem. Rev. 1981, 81, 79. (b) Pearson, R. G. Inorg. Chem. 1973, 12, 712. (c) Navarro, R.; Urriolabeitia, E. P. J. Chem. Soc., Dalton Trans. 1999, 4111. Recently, the term transphobia has been proposed to describe the difficulty of coordinating mutually trans phosphine and aryl ligands in paladium complexes, see: (d) Vicente, J.; Abad, J. A.; Frankland, A. D.; Ramírez De Arellano, M. C. Chem. Eur. J. 1999, 5, 3066. (e) Vicente, J.; Arcas, A.; Bautista, D.; Jones, P. G. Organometallics 1997, 16, 2127.

    • The imine cyclopalladated derivatives permit the separation in 85% yield of the corresponding diastereomers containing benzylcyclohexylphenylphosphine coordinated with a d.e. higher than 95%. In contrast, when optically active palladacycles containing primary or tertiary amines are used as resolving agents, the maximum yield reported for the resolution of this phosphine is 70%; see Ref. 5a
